Abstract

Background: Mode of communication in emergency is of prime importance when it comes to patient management or reporting of the patient. An expert opinion and timely information to senior consultants is to be always soughed whenever in doubt. A common electronic media platform can be very beneficial in such circumstances. Methods: All the residents and consultants of emergency team were connected on a common platform using WhatsApp and upload of information was done by residents on duty which was cleared by consultants. Results: A decrease in response time about diagnosis or management of patient was observed to be decreased along with more clear and visual information was available to seniors for their advice. A common platform for reporting and consultation was more appreciated among surgeons and Orthopedician. Conclusions: Using a common electronic platform for communication may be felt cumbersome with some amount of extra burden but definitely results into more accurate delivery of care to patients with in time expert opinion.
